Woman on cruise ship missing

MIAMI, Dec. 26 (UPI) -- The U.S. Coast Guard and Mexican forces searched the waters off Cancun, Mexico, for a woman reported missing on a cruise ship.

The hunt for Jennifer Feitz, 36, began just before 4 a.m. on the Norwegian Pearl when her husband told cruise employees he could not find his wife, CNN reported. After the crew found no signs of the woman on board the ship, officers notified the Coast Guard.

AnneMarie Mathews, a spokeswoman for the cruise line, said that the Norwegian Pearl began a seven-day trip to the western Caribbean on Sunday.

The Coast Guard dispatched a jet and a fixed-wing aircraft from Clearwater, Fla., to do an aerial search, Nick Ameen, a petty officer third class and spokesman for the Coast Guard said. The Mexican government supplied a helicopter and three search crews.
